        대학 여자 멀리뛰기 엘리트 선수와 아마추어 선수의 각운동량 비교분석

        신의수(Shin, Eui-Su) 한국체육과학회 2022 한국체육과학회지 Vol.31 No.5

        The purpose of this study was to compare and analyze the angular momentum of the lower extremities and upper extremities and the resultant velocity of the COM(center of mass) in the long jump motions of elite female long jump athletes and amateur athletes. This study obtained the following results. First, the average angular momentum of the right arm of the elite female long jump athlete and amateur athlete during the long jump action was high in all events except Event 4, Event 5, and Event 6, and there was a significant difference in Event 8. Second, the average angular momentum of the left arm during the long jump of elite female long jump athletes and amateur athletes was high in all events except Event 3, Event 4, and Event 5, and there was a significant difference in Event 8. Third, the average angular momentum of the right leg of the elite female long jump athlete and amateur athlete during the long jump was high in all events except for Event 3 and Event 4. There was a significant difference between Event 3 and Event 8. Fourth, the average angular momentum of the left leg of the elite female long jump athlete and amateur athlete during the long jump operation was high in all Events except Event 1 and Event 5, and there was a significant difference in Event 8. Fifth, the average COM resultant velocity of the elite female long jump athlete and amateur athlete during the long jump action showed that the average COM resultant velocity of all Event elite athlete was high, showing a significant difference.

        경호무도 수련 시 전방낙법 동작의 근활성도 분석

        신의수(Shin, Eui-Su) 한국체육과학회 2015 한국체육과학회지 Vol.24 No.6

        The study is to present quantitative data needed to effectively control the impact force through the EMG(Electromyography) analysis of the students" security martial arts forward breakfall movement. The results of this study are as follows. First, t he m uscle activity o f the security m artial a rts forward break fall ready posture(E1) in t he movement, there was no significant difference. But that was observed muscle activity of the right and left of the erector spinae appear high, then the triceps, Pectoralis major, upper arm triceps appeared in order. Second, the muscle activity of the primary impact point(E2) in the security martial arts forward breakfall movement, there was no significant difference. But it was born with the right brachial triceps muscle activity appeared high on the left, and then appeared in the deltoid, Pectoralis major, erector spinae order. Third, the muscle activity of the secondary impact point in the security martial arts forward breakfall movement, there was no significant difference. Both are skilled it showed that the muscle activity of the right and left deltoid high, unskilled both the right and left of the Pectoralis major muscle activity showed that high. Fourth, the muscle activity of the secondary impact point in the security martial arts forward breakfall movement, there was no significant difference. Pectoralis major muscle activity was observed, however, the right and on the left appears high, then the triceps, the brachial triceps, those in the erector spinae order. This study concluded comprehensive if security martial arts forward breakfall movement of trains do when primary impact point at an effective shock absorption to the brachial triceps and deltoid to effectively use secondary impact point at the elbow in the coming shock reduction should be expected to be.

        가사노동 설거지 시 테이핑과 스트레칭운동이 만성요통 주부에게 미치는 효과에 관한 생체역학적 연구

        신의수(Shin, Eui-Su),김준식(Kim, Jun-Sik) 한국체육과학회 2021 한국체육과학회지 Vol.30 No.6

        The purpose of this study was to analysis the effects of lumbar taping and stretching exercise interventions on trunk range of motion, pressure pain, and lumbar muscle activity during housework washing dishes for chronic low back pain homemakers, and the following conclusions were drawn. First, it was found that lumbar taping and stretching exercise interventions were effective for trunk flexion, extension, left flexion, and right flexion during housework washing dishes for chronic low back pain homemakers. Second, it was found that lumbar taping and stretching exercise interventions were effective for low back tenderness during housework washing dishes for homemakers with chronic low back pain. Third, lumbar taping and stretching exercise interventions were also effective in L3 muscle activity during housework washing dishes for chronic low back pain homemakers. Summarizing the results of this study, it can be seen that simple lumbar taping and stretching exercise interventions were effective in the trunk range of motion, pain, and lumbar muscle activity during housework washing dishes for homemakers with chronic low back pain.

        중학교 남자 체조선수 마루운동 착지 동작 시 상해요인의 운동학적 분석

        신의수(Shin, Eui-Su),최정규(Choi, Jung-Kyu),김상두(Kim, Sang-Doo) 한국체육과학회 2015 한국체육과학회지 Vol.24 No.3

        The purpose of this study is to conduct a kinematic analysis on the causes of injury when six. Athletes of a sports middle school in city D carry out their 360° twist landing in floor exercise. The study results offered the following findings. First, the time it took to carry out the landing was .14 ±.04 s. Second, the range of motion in the CM(center of mass) on the left and right was within .03 ±.02 m, and within 34 ±. 09m for front and back. The range of motion in CM vertically was within .15 ±. 04 m. Third, the CM horizontal velocity was 2.72 ±. 24 m/s for Event 1 and 1.83 ±.69 m/s for Event 2. The CM vertical velocity was -2.96 ± 45 m/s for Event 1 and -.28 ±. 24 m/s for Event 2. Fourth, during landing the joints in the hip, knees and ankles were bended. The range of angle during bending was, in the order of hip joints, knee joints and ankle joints. Fifth, the outward rotation angle of the knee at landing was reduced. Taken together, the above findings suggest that taking more time when landing through a 360° twist landing movement and having an appropriate bending range for the lower limb joints can help reduce the cause of injury. It also seems important to reduce the outward rotating angle of the knees.

        무도 전방낙법 동작 시 충격력 감소 요인의 운동역학적 분석

        신의수(Eui Su Shin),오정환(Cheong Hwan Oh),홍수영(Soo Young Hong),박찬호(Chan Ho Park) 한국사회체육학회 2014 한국사회체육학회지 Vol.0 No.57

        The purpose of this study was to provide basic quantitative data to minimize the impact occurring during forward breakfall by the comparative analysis of kinetic factors through 3D motion analysis and analysis of GRF of the forward breakfall of the martialarts targeting 10 skilled and 10 unskilled subjects. The following are the findings. First, the total time taken for forward breakfall of the martial arts showed 1.53±0.04 s for skilled, and 1.41±0.06 s for unskilled subjects. Second, forward breakfall of the martial arts operation showed significant left and right position of center of mass in P2, P3, and P4. In addition, the unskilled subjects showed larger forward and rearward position in P1, P2, P3, and P4, while the skilled subjects showed larger vertical position in P2. And the unskilled subjects showed faster forward and rear movement of center of mass in P2, P3, and P4, respectively. And unskilled subjects showed faster vertical velocity of center of mass in P2 and P3. Third, as for the upper extremity joint angle during forward breakfall, skilled subjects showed larger right shoulder joint angle in P4, and unskilled subjects showed larger left shoulder joint angle in P2 and P3. Unskilled subjects showed greater elbow joint angle both right and left side in P1 and P3, and skilled subjects demonstrated larger wrist joint angle both right and left side in P1. Fourth, the forward breakfall of the martial arts did not show any difference between left and right side in the GRF, but unskilled subjects proved a significantly greater forward and backward GRF in the secondary point of impact(E3) both right and left sides. The skilled subjects showed a significantly greater vertical GRF in the primary point of impact (E2), and unskilled subjects showed a larger vertical reaction force in the secondary point of impact (E3), respectively.

        측방낙상과 측방낙법 동작의 운동역학적 비교분석

        신의수(Shin, Eui-Su),최정규(Choi, Jung-Kyu),김상두(Kim, Sang-Doo) 한국체육과학회 2014 한국체육과학회지 Vol.23 No.3

        The purpose of this study was to provide a quantitative base data needed to minimize physical injuries from side fall by comparing and analyzing the kinetic of the motion of side fall and side breakfall. The subjects for the motion of side fall were five healthy male university students, while the subjects for the motion of side breakfall were five male black belt holder. For the video recording, nine high speed cameras (Motionmaster 100, KOR) were used and for the analysis of impact force, a force plat (AMTI, USA) was used. To analyze the video and impact force, the program Kwon3d XP(Visol, KOR) was used. Using the technical statistical of SPPSS 18.0 program, the average and standard deviation were calculated and an independent t-test conducted to verify the difference between groups. The conclusions drawn from this study are as follows. First, the duration time was longer for side breakfall at P2 (p<.05), while there was no significant difference in total duration time. Second, the COM(center of mass) position was shortest for the left/right and front/back range of side breakfall, and there was a statistically sifnificant differecne at E2 and E3(p<.05). Third, the COM(center of mass) velocity was slowest for side breakfall at E3 where the impact force of the hip is at its highest, with a statistically significant difference (p<.05). Fourth, the impact velocity of the hand when it hits the ground at E2 showed the highest for side brekfall with a statistically significant difference (p<.05). Fifth, the impact velocity of the hip was highest for side breakfall at the left/right velocity and vertical velocity, with a statistically significant difference (p<.05). The greatest impact force of the hip was 1.06 BW for side breakfall and 2.15 BW for side fall with as tatistically significant difference (p<.05). Synthesis of the results is as follows. Suggest that in order to reduce hip impact force, the following factors are important. Side fall during a long time and you need to slow down the COM velocity. And you should slow down the impact velocity of the hip.

        청소년의 스마트폰 사용 중 간헐적 경부 스트레칭 운동이 근골격계 건강위험요인에 미치는 영향

        신의수(Shin, Eui-Su) 한국체육과학회 2021 한국체육과학회지 Vol.30 No.4

        The purpose of this study was to analyze how intermittent stretching exercise affects musculoskeletal health risk factors(neck range of motion, muscle activity, pressure pain) when using the smartphone in adolescents. The results of this study are as follows. First, there was no significant difference in musculoskeletal health risk factors pre and post smartphone use in the experimental group. Second, there were significant differences in musculoskeletal health risk factors pre and post smartphone use of the control group. Third, there was no significant difference in musculoskeletal health risk factors before the use of smartphone in the experimental group and the control group. Fourth, the musculoskeletal health risk factors before the use of smartphone in the experimental group and the control group showed a significant difference in muscle activity of the levator scapula, and no significant difference in other factors. From the above results, it was found that when adolescents use their smartphones for 60 minutes without stretching exercises in a chair sitting position, it was found that the musculoskeletal system (neck range of motion, muscle activity, pressure pain) was negatively affected, but 15 minutes It was found that the negative effects on the musculoskeletal system were significantly reduced when simple neck stretching exercises were performed in units.

        용무도 앞굴러치기 동작의 운동역학적 분석

        임재오(Lim, Jae-O),신의수(Shin, Eui-Su),이광무(Lee, Kwang-Moo),이재훈(Lee, Jae-Hun) 한국체육과학회 2021 한국체육과학회지 Vol.30 No.4

        The purpose of this study is to kinetic analysis of the apgulleochigi motion of Yongmoodo. And the kinematic variables such as the duration time, COM(center of mass) displacement and velocity, the maximum impact force at landing were analyzed. And the following conclusions were drawn. First, the duration time of the apgulleochigi motion of Yongmoodo was 0.42±0.06 s in P1, 0.48±0.06 s in P2, 0.24±0.10 s in P3, and the total time was 1.14±0.16 s. In addition, the time required for each section during apgulleochigi motion of Yongmoodo showed a long duration time in the order of P2, P1, and P3. Second, the left and right displacements of COM of apgulleochigi motion of Yongmoodo were 0.40±0.05 m for E1, 0.39±0.03 m for E2, 0.39±0.08 m for E3, and 0.37±0.07 m for E4. The displacement before and after COM was 0.52±0.28 m for E1, 0.86±0.22 m for E2, 1.44±0.12 m for E3, and 1.86±0.13 m for E4. COM vertical displacement was 0.99±0.03 m for E1, 0.68±0.04 m for E2, 0.55±0.12 m for E3, and 0.31±0.01 m for E4. Third, the COM left and right velocity of apgulleochigi motion of Yongmoodo are -0.03±0.07 m/s for E1, 0.00±0.07 m/s for E2, -0.02±0.18 m/s for E3, and -0.13±0.33 m/s for E4. The velocity before and after COM was 0.69±0.22 m/s for E1, 0.86±0.18 m/s for E2, 1.56±0.52 m/s for E3, and 2.03±0.15 m/s for E4. The COM vertical speed was -0.36±0.15 m/s for E1, -0.89±0.17 m/s for E2, -1.19±0.44 m/s for E3, and -0.03±0.34 m/s for E4. Fourth, in the apgulleochigi motion of Yongmoodo, the maximum impact force generated by the hand closing to the ground was 1.76±0.25 BW. In summary, in the apgulleochigi motion of Yongmoodo, it would be advantageous to increase the duration of P1 and increase the impact speed upon landing in order to minimize the impact. In addition, it is judged that the impact force is reduced as the right arm is closer to the ground before the upper body is lowered and the vertical velocity of the COM is slowed down during an impact.

        복싱 원·투 스트레이트 동작의 운동역학적 특성 분석

        오정환(Oh, Cheong-Hwan),신의수(Shin, Eui-Su),김진표(Kim, Jin-Pyo),노대성(Rho, Dae-Sung) 한국체육과학회 2012 한국체육과학회지 Vol.21 No.6

        The purpose of this study was to through the kinetics analysis on the one-two straight punch motion in boxing, Provide the basic data by which a training method can be found to improve the boxing techniques for the beginners and experts. To do so, this study chose 4 boxing players as test objects and recorded their motions to analyze time consumed, the velocity and distance of a fist, the angles of a joint and ground reaction force. For the video recording, 9 infrared cameras (Motionmaster 100, Visol) and 2 force platform (AMTI, USA) were used to measure ground reaction force. The recorded data was analyzed by Kwon3D XP program and the findings are as follows; First, phase of a left straight punch took a short time in the total distance time. Second, compared to the left straight distance time, the right straight took a longer distance time and a faster instantaneous velocity. Third, lower limb Joints showed more dynamic than right ones. And ankle joints showed more motions than buttock ones. Fourth, at the impact moment of left and right straight punches, resultant of the ground reaction force(GRF) were exerted on the front foot for both punches.
